BJP caught in a cleft on Vananchal
Spelling fresh trouble for the BJP, eleven of its MPs from Bihar have threatened to resign their Lok Sabha seats if the government went back on its promise of creating the state of Vananchal even as ally Samata Party's MPs walked out of the Lok Sabha protesting against the move.
Congress has a long way to go, Sonia reminds partymen
Congress President Sonia Gandhi has put in a huge dose of patience in her address to the Congress Parliamentary Party meeting, saying her party is back to business, but it has a lot more to do before reclaiming its past glory.
Govt to table white paper on ISI's activities
With Pakistan-sponsored infiltration and terrorist attempts on the rise in different parts of India, the government has told Parliament that it will soon table a white paper in Parliament on the activities of Pakistan's Inter-services Intelligence (ISI) in India.
